Severe Weather Threats Moves into Lower Great Lakes,Tennessee Valley on Wednesday

Severe weather is expected on Wednesday from the Lower Great Lakes into the Tennessee Valley. Primary threats will be damaging winds and large hail. Isolated tornadoes will also be possible. Farther south, Tuesday night thunderstorms could continue into Wednesday morning with some damaging winds and hail.
